    Awesome insider view as always. Thanks Doug. I’d love to see a bit on the history behind the grandstands…which is the oldest standing today (I think it’s E in turn one?) and what was the last original grandstand/remnant of the 1909-11 era and when was it replaced…

    • @v12tommy
      @v12tommy 2 ปีที่แล้ว +3

      According to the speedway when Tom Carnegie passed, there is no current structure viewable from inside the track that predates 1946. (There are several buildings outside the track though) The oldest structure viewable inside is the medical center, built in 1948. I believe Stand E is the oldest standing, as it was the first double deck grandstand built, and was constructed in 1949.
